using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using System.Data;
using System.Configuration.Assemblies;
using CommercialTaxMissionMode.ObjectModel;
using Oracle.DataAccess.Client;
using Oracle.DataAccess.Types;
namespace CommercialTaxMissionMode.DAL
{
public class OracleHelper
{
string constrg = System.Configuration.ConfigurationManager.ConnectionStrings["ConStrng"].ToString();
#region Reader
/// <summary>
/// Returns a datareader for the oracle command
/// </summary>
/// <param name="constrg"></param>
/// <param name="cmdText"></param>
/// <param name="prms"></param>
/// <returns></returns>
public OracleDataReader ExecuteReader(string cmdText, OracleParameter[] prms, CommandType Type)
{
try
{
OracleConnection conn = new OracleConnection(constrg);
using (OracleCommand cmd = new OracleCommand(cmdText, conn))
{
cmd.CommandType = Type;
if (prms != null)
{
foreach (OracleParameter p in prms)
{
cmd.Parameters.Add(p);
}
}
conn.Open();
return cmd.ExecuteReader(CommandBehavior.CloseConnection);
}
}
catch (Exception ex)
{
throw ex;
}
}
/// <summary>
/// Returns a datareader for the oracle command
/// </summary>
/// <param name="constrg"></param>
/// <param name="cmdText"></param>
/// <returns></returns>
public OracleDataReader ExecuteReader(string cmdText, CommandType Type)
{
return ExecuteReader(cmdText, null, Type);
}
#endregion
#region DataSet
/// <summary>
/// Returns a dataset for the oracle command
/// </summary>
/// <param name="constrg"></param>
/// <param name="cmdText"></param>
/// <param name="prms"></param>
/// <returns></returns>
public DataSet ExecuteDataSet(string cmdText, OracleParameter[] prms,CommandType Type)
{
try
{
using (OracleConnection conn = new OracleConnection(constrg))
{
DataSet ds = new DataSet();
using (OracleCommand cmd = new OracleCommand(cmdText, conn))
{
cmd.CommandType = Type;
if (prms != null)
{
foreach (OracleParameter p in prms)
{
cmd.Parameters.Add(p);
}
}
OracleDataAdapter adpt = new OracleDataAdapter(cmd);
adpt.Fill(ds);
return ds;
}
}
}
catch (Exception ex)
{
throw ex;
}
}
/// <summary>
/// Returns a dataset for the oracle command
/// </summary>
/// <param name="constrg"></param>
/// <param name="cmdText"></param>
/// <returns></returns>
public DataSet ExecuteDataSet(string cmdText, CommandType Type)
{
return ExecuteDataSet(cmdText, null, Type);
}
#endregion
#region DataTable
/// <summary>
/// Returns a datatable for the oracle command
/// </summary>
/// <param name="constrg"></param>
/// <param name="cmdText"></param>
/// <param name="prms"></param>
/// <returns></returns>
public DataTable ExecuteDataTable(string cmdText, OracleParameter[] prms, CommandType Type)
{
try
{
using (OracleConnection conn = new OracleConnection(constrg))
{
DataTable dt = new DataTable();
using (OracleCommand cmd = new OracleCommand(cmdText, conn))
{
cmd.CommandType = Type;
if (prms != null)
{
foreach (OracleParameter p in prms)
{
cmd.Parameters.Add(p);
}
}
OracleDataAdapter adpt = new OracleDataAdapter(cmd);
adpt.Fill(dt);
return dt;
}
}
}
catch (Exception ex)
{
throw ex;
}
}
/// <summary>
/// Returns a datatable for the oracle command
/// </summary>
/// <param name="constrg"></param>
/// <param name="cmdText"></param>
/// <returns></returns>
public DataTable ExecuteDataTable(string cmdText, CommandType Type)
{
return ExecuteDataTable(cmdText, null, Type);
}
#endregion
#region NonQuery
/// <summary>
/// Executes a non query
/// </summary>
/// <param name="constrg"></param>
/// <param name="cmdText"></param>
/// <param name="prms"></param>
/// <returns></returns>
public int ExecuteNonQuery(string cmdText, OracleParameter[] prms, CommandType Type)
{
try
{
using (OracleConnection conn = new OracleConnection(constrg))
{
using (OracleCommand cmd = new OracleCommand(cmdText, conn))
{
cmd.CommandType = Type;
if (prms != null)
{
foreach (OracleParameter p in prms)
{
cmd.Parameters.Add(p);
}
}
conn.Open();
return cmd.ExecuteNonQuery();
}
}
}
catch (Exception ex)
{
throw ex;
}
}
/// <summary>
/// Executes a non query
/// </summary>
/// <param name="constrg"></param>
/// <param name="cmdText"></param>
/// <returns></returns>
public int ExecuteNonQuery(string cmdText, CommandType Type)
{
return ExecuteNonQuery(cmdText, null, Type);
}
#endregion
#region Scalar
/// <summary>
/// Returns the scalar object of the query
/// </summary>
/// <param name="constrg"></param>
/// <param name="cmdText"></param>
/// <param name="prms"></param>
/// <returns></returns>
public object ExecuteScalar(string cmdText, OracleParameter[] prms, CommandType Type)
{
try
{
using (OracleConnection conn = new OracleConnection(constrg))
{
using (OracleCommand cmd = new OracleCommand(cmdText, conn))
{
cmd.CommandType = Type;
if (prms != null)
{
foreach (OracleParameter p in prms)
{
cmd.Parameters.Add(p);
}
}
conn.Open();
return cmd.ExecuteScalar();
}
}
}
catch (Exception ex)
{
throw ex;
}
}
/// <summary>
/// Returns the scalar object of the query
/// </summary>
/// <param name="constrg"></param>
/// <param name="cmdText"></param>
/// <returns></returns>
public object ExecuteScalar(string cmdText, CommandType Type)
{
return ExecuteScalar(cmdText, null, Type);
}
#endregion
}
}
